Force India: Marussia F1 proposal 'lacked substance'

Force India deputy team principal Bob Fernley has defended the decision taken by Formula One's Strategy Group to reject Marussia's entry with its 2014 car, after the team came under fire for blocking the proposal. Fernley stated there were too many 'compliance issues' and the submission by Marussia 'lacked substance'. The group, consisting of the FIA, Bernie Ecclestone and the leading six teams – Ferrari, Mercedes, Red Bull, McLaren, Williams and Force India – met in Paris on Thursday and rejected Marussia's entry for the 2015 season with last year's car, after the team confirmed it would not be able to produce a new car for the first race of the season at Melbourne in March.
